Sparse Recovery with Orthogonal Matching Pursuit under RIP
arXiv:1005.2249
Abstract
This paper presents a new analysis for the orthogonal matching pursuit (OMP) algorithm. It is shown that if the restricted isometry property (RIP) is satisfied at sparsity level , then OMP can recover a -sparse signal in 2-norm. For compressed sensing applications, this result implies that in order to uniformly recover a -sparse signal in $\Real^d$, only random projections are needed. This analysis improves earlier results on OMP that depend on stronger conditions such as mutual incoherence that can only be satisfied with random projections.
